# Break-Glass: Catalog Cache Invalidation

Scope: the Pinrow product catalog at Veldstone Retail. If stale prices persist after a purge and the Hollowmere invalidation queue is wedged, use break-glass to flush the edge tier directly. Contractors: get verbal sign-off from the catalog lead first. Steps: open the Hollowmere admin shell, select emergency-flush, confirm the tenant, and run it once — repeated flushes thrash the origin. Access is logged and expires after 20 minutes. Unseal the admin shell with the passphrase below.

recovery phrase for kahop-tajog: istix-casvan

Action item: the Ostwell kiosk watchdog restarted the Lanternview app repeatedly during the December freeze because its heartbeat window was shorter than the splash-screen load time. Future maintainers should never tighten the window without re-measuring cold boot on actual kiosk hardware. The corrected watchdog constants we settled on are recorded below.

tuning table, faduf-baduf:
PRIORITIES = {
    "ulavan": 191,
    "silys": 750,
    "goriel": 238,
    "kelmir": 66,
    "wendor": 432,
}

Subject: Budget ask for Q3 — Tilgate rollout

Hi all,

Quick one before Thursday's board session: we're requesting an extra 240k to push the Tilgate platform into the Verlow market ahead of schedule. Marnie's team has the numbers ready, and the payback window looks tight but real. Full deck attached. One more thing the board should see before we vote:

board note of bajop-yaweg: The western region missed its Pelys quota by 58.0 percent last quarter. Pelysek Foods plans to raise the Belius list price by 44.0 percent in July. The steering committee signed off on a budget of $133.8 million for Project Pelax. The renewal with Zoraelix Systems closes at $61.9 million a year, 12.7 percent above the last contract.

## Deploying the Gatewick Proctor Queue

Deploys are pretty painless: push to main, wait for the pipeline, then watch the queue drain dashboard for five minutes. If candidates pile up mid-exam, roll back first and ask questions later — the queue replays safely. Everything the workers care about lives in one config block, shown here for reference.

settings of bafof-yagef:
JOROX_PIN=8740
JOROX_TENANT=pelox
JOROX_METRICS_HOST=metrics.jorox.qorvelworks.internal
JOROX_SEAL=seal_c78f63c1
JOROX_STANDBY_TEAM=norax